Output 76866b8f6d2127c013ef377822591c9fcaf0ceaf1e7e456a94a874590a1694c4:1

value
66661430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c528453cdd495d18e76e152375315241f7b4351a OP_EQUAL
address
MRsdbG7aQBqmiaYNrroC2qi3fX2c5NzyYm
transaction
76866b8f6d2127c013ef377822591c9fcaf0ceaf1e7e456a94a874590a1694c4
spent
true